Dutch

Pronunciation

  • (file)

Noun

nazi m (plural nazi's, diminutive nazi'tje n)

  1. Nazi, member of the NSDAP
  2. a member of similar movements, whether Nazi, fascist, neo-Nazi or in any other way ultranationalist
  3. (slang, derogatory, offensive) an authoritarian, strict or nitpicky person

Spanish

Etymology

From German Nazi, a shortening of Nationalsozialist (National Socialist).

Pronunciation

  • (Castilian) IPA(key): /ˈna.θi/
  • (Others) IPA(key): /ˈna.si/

Noun

nazi m or f (plural nazis)

  1. Nazi

Adjective

nazi (plural nazis)

  1. Nazi

Swahili

Noun

nazi (n class, plural nazi)

  1. coconut (especially a mature coconut)

Derived terms

  • mnazi (coconut palm)

See also

  • dafu (young coconut)
  • mbata (old coconut used for copra)
